Epichlorohydrin (CO, ECO, GECO)
Hydrin® is the trade name of epichlorohydrin elastomers made by Zeon Chemicals. epichlorohydrin elastomers are available as a homopolymer(CO), copolymer(ECO,GCO),
and terpolmer(GECO). All epichlorohydrin rubbers offer low temperature flexibilities; resistance to oils, fuel and common solvents; higher temperature resistance than NBR; good weather ability and good dynamic properties.
Cure system - Sulfur-Cured vs. Peroxide-Cured
ECO are usually Peroxide-cured for standard compounds of Ge Mao. It also can be Sulfur-cured to improve flexible property in dynamic system but will reduce the heat resistance and cause poorer compression set.

• The typical applications of epichlorohydrin are fuels or LPG system in automotive.
General Information
ASTM D 1418 Designation: CO, ECO, GECO
ISO/DIN 1629 Designation: CO, ECO, GECO
ASTM D2000 / SAE J 200 Codes: CH
Standard Color(s): Black
Hardness Range: 50o 80 Shore A
Relative Cost: Medium
Service Temperatures
Standard Low Temperature: -40°C / -40°F
Standard High Temperature: 100°C / 212°F
Special Compound High Temperature: 135°C / 275°F
